L-R: Artist Robert Butler, Lieutenant Governor Toni Jennings, Secretary of State Sue Cobb and Florida Farm Bureau Federation President Carl B. Loop Jr.
Accompanying note: "Artist Robert Butler was one of the Highwaymen, a group of African American painters who traveled the highways of South Florida selling their paintings of Florida landscapes to businesses and individuals... Butler is one of twenty-six Highwaymen painters who were inducted as a group into the Florida Hall of Fame in 2004. Currently Butler serves as president of the Highwaymen Artists, LLC."
The painting, "Morning at the Old Capitol", was commissioned by the Florida Farm Bureau and unveiled on March 21, 2006 at the Old Capitol.
